About Si Kham, Thailand

G'day, mates! Ready for a Thai adventure that's a bit off the well-trodden tourist path? Si Kham, a charming town nestled in northeastern Thailand, offers a unique blend of laid-back vibes and rich cultural experiences. Forget the bustling cityscapes – Si Kham is all about authentic Thai life, stunning natural beauty, and a warm welcome that'll make you feel right at home. Think friendly locals, delicious street food, and a chance to truly immerse yourself in Thai culture. It's the perfect escape for those seeking a genuine, less-frantic Thai holiday.

Top Attractions & Must-Visit Places in Si Kham, Thailand

Si Kham might be smaller than some other Thai destinations, but it packs a punch when it comes to things to see and do.

  • Wat Phra That Si Kham: This stunning temple is a must-see, boasting impressive architecture and a peaceful atmosphere. Take your time exploring the grounds and soaking up the spiritual energy.
  • Si Kham National Museum: Delve into the history and culture of the region at this fascinating museum. You'll discover intriguing artifacts and learn about the area's rich past.
  • Local Markets: Get lost in the vibrant colours and aromas of Si Kham's bustling markets. It's the perfect place to pick up unique souvenirs and experience the daily life of the locals.
  • The Mekong River: Take a boat trip along the mighty Mekong River and witness breathtaking scenery. You might even spot some wildlife along the way!

When’s the Best Time to Go?

Si Kham enjoys a tropical climate. The best time to visit is during the cooler, dry season (November to April). However, the shoulder seasons (May and October) can also be pleasant, with fewer crowds.

Transportation Options in Si Kham, Thailand

Getting around Si Kham is relatively easy. You can easily explore the town on foot or by bicycle. Songthaews (shared taxis) are also readily available for longer distances.
